Citigroup Collaborates with Coinbase to Facilitate Stablecoin Payments

Citigroup and Coinbase: Pioneering Stablecoin Solutions for Corporate Payments

In a strategic move reflecting the growing intersection between traditional finance and blockchain technology, Citigroup has announced a partnership with Coinbase, one of the leading cryptocurrency exchanges. With Citigroup managing over $2.5 trillion in assets, this collaboration aims to facilitate the use of stablecoins for corporate payments, signaling Wall Street’s enhanced embrace of blockchain innovations. This initiative could revolutionize how businesses manage cross-border transactions and liquidity.

A Step Towards Real-Time Payments with Stablecoins

The partnership centers on enhancing how Citigroup’s institutional clients can transition funds between blockchain-based accounts and traditional banking, aiming for greater efficiency. According to a Bloomberg report, Citigroup is investing in developing faster, flexible payment options leveraging stablecoin technology. The head of payments for Citigroup’s Services division, Debopama Sen, emphasized that an increasing number of clients are seeking to utilize programmable and conditional payments available 24/7. Unlike traditional banking systems, which often are restricted by weekends and lengthy settlement periods, this initiative promises to deliver a more agile solution for corporate financial operations.

Testing the Waters with On-Chain Transactions

As part of this forward-looking initiative, Citigroup will test the feasibility of enabling on-chain stablecoin transactions in the coming months. This is a noteworthy evolution in Citigroup’s approach to digital finance, given the bank’s recent initiatives, including the launch of a blockchain-based platform for instant transfers of tokenized deposits. The firm has also begun exploring custody services tailored for crypto ETFs and stablecoins, demonstrating its commitment to integrating digital assets into its broader financial services framework.

The Promise of Stablecoins in the Financial Ecosystem

Sen has referred to stablecoins as "an enabler in the digital payment ecosystem," underscoring their potential to enhance transactional capabilities for global clients. By incorporating stablecoins into their payment systems, Citigroup aims to provide more robust and versatile financial solutions that align with the evolving needs of businesses. This move is indicative of a larger trend, as traditional financial institutions recognize the importance of adapting to digital advancements and client expectations.

Market Optimism: Stocks on the Rise

The partnership between Citigroup and Coinbase has been well received by market analysts, with projections suggesting that the stablecoin market could surpass $1 trillion within the next five years—an increase of approximately $700 billion. This anticipated growth has already spurred interest among major banks, asset managers, and payment networks, all eager to modernize their financial infrastructures using blockchain technology. Following the announcement, Coinbase’s stock price rose by 4.01% to $368.66, while Citigroup shares saw a 1.39% bump to $100.15. These increases reflect a collective optimism surrounding the potential impact of the stablecoin pilot on both companies’ digital payments strategies.

Expanding Institutional Footprint through Innovation

Coinbase is not just a passive participant in this collaboration; the exchange continues to enhance its institutional presence, having already established infrastructure for more than 250 banks and financial institutions globally. Brian Foster, a Coinbase executive, has noted that specialized systems tailored for these clients simplify processes surrounding trading, asset staking, and payments. The partnership with Citigroup illustrates the growing interest in the practical applications of blockchain technology, particularly in the realm of payments using stablecoins and asset tokenization. This alliance not only positions both companies at the forefront of a financial revolution but also serves to reassure stakeholders about the future of digital finance.
